Abstract
Debate by Sociology B3 students on mass media (press, radio, television). Issues discussed include: What is socially-responsible media? Do financial influences predominate? Do we have an adequate variety of sources? Conference convened by Brian Graetz. -- Speakers: Brian Graetz, Jack Wheeler, Johnathon Moore, Margaret Andrew, Eddie Reginato, Andrew Petherbridge, Alan Oakman. -- Recorded 5 August 1980.
